Output 072127237efe8e97db52249200b0ad88875fa6963785d1f4948a982b157ec2a6:39

value
17858522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 368d7bece13e11f3f3d980ae1d33c8640776f3be OP_EQUAL
address
36fTuPWzADHgKVMP4q6b5FxPyoVpoRgmSL
transaction
072127237efe8e97db52249200b0ad88875fa6963785d1f4948a982b157ec2a6